WebThe Shapiro-Wilk test is a statistical test used to check if a continuous variable follows a normal distribution. The null hypothesis (H 0) states that the variable is normally distributed, and the alternative hypothesis (H 1) states that the variable is NOT normally distributed. The null-hypothesis of this test is that the population is normally distributed. Thus, if the p value is less than the chosen alpha level, then the null hypothesis is rejected and there is evidence that the data tested are not normally distributed.
